diff options
author | avilla <avilla@FreeBSD.org> | 2011-01-14 23:39:30 +0800 |
---|---|---|
committer | avilla <avilla@FreeBSD.org> | 2011-01-14 23:39:30 +0800 |
commit | 4757292793cf5db32fdd55a602178c6331c32101 (patch) | |
tree | a08c03edbfe31fcfb5823a4f8f9ee152cacd95d6 /multimedia | |
parent | e81b9bcb2acf78fa6b3bb552a54c0b5e20bc55e6 (diff) | |
download | freebsd-ports-gnome-4757292793cf5db32fdd55a602178c6331c32101.tar.gz freebsd-ports-gnome-4757292793cf5db32fdd55a602178c6331c32101.tar.zst freebsd-ports-gnome-4757292793cf5db32fdd55a602178c6331c32101.zip |
- Update to 0.6.0.
Feature safe: yes
Diffstat (limited to 'multimedia')
-rw-r--r-- | multimedia/mlt/Makefile | 25 | ||||
-rw-r--r-- | multimedia/mlt/distinfo | 5 | ||||
-rw-r--r-- | multimedia/mlt/pkg-plist | 10 |
3 files changed, 21 insertions, 19 deletions
diff --git a/multimedia/mlt/Makefile b/multimedia/mlt/Makefile index 9be622f5599b..1f7beba61b1a 100644 --- a/multimedia/mlt/Makefile +++ b/multimedia/mlt/Makefile @@ -5,7 +5,7 @@ # $FreeBSD$ PORTNAME= mlt -PORTVERSION= 0.5.10 +PORTVERSION= 0.6.0 CATEGORIES= multimedia MASTER_SITES= SF/${PORTNAME}/${PORTNAME} @@ -25,7 +25,6 @@ GNU_CONFIGURE= yes CONFIGURE_ARGS= --disable-debug \ --enable-gpl USE_GMAKE= yes -MAKE_ENV= LDFLAGS="-lc" # Required by FreeBSD 6.X. CFLAGS+= -I${LOCALBASE}/include USE_LDCONFIG= ${PREFIX}/lib ${PREFIX}/lib/mlt @@ -46,6 +45,7 @@ OPTIONS= AVFORMAT "Avformat module" on \ SOX "Sound eXchange module" on \ SSE "SSE support (requires MMX)" off \ SSE2 "SSE2 support (requires SSE)" off \ + SWFDEC "Swfdec module" on \ VORBIS "Vorbis module" on .include <bsd.port.options.mk> @@ -156,6 +156,15 @@ CONFIGURE_ARGS+= --enable-sse2 CONFIGURE_ARGS+= --disable-sse2 .endif +.ifndef(WITHOUT_SWFDEC) +LIB_DEPENDS+= swfdec-0.8.0:${PORTSDIR}/graphics/swfdec +CONFIGURE_ARGS+= --enable-swfdec +PLIST_SUB+= SWFDEC="" +.else +CONFIGURE_ARGS+= --disable-swfdec +PLIST_SUB+= SWFDEC="@comment " +.endif + .ifndef(WITHOUT_VORBIS) LIB_DEPENDS+= vorbis.4:${PORTSDIR}/audio/libvorbis CONFIGURE_ARGS+= --enable-vorbis @@ -165,17 +174,7 @@ CONFIGURE_ARGS+= --disable-vorbis PLIST_SUB+= VORBIS="@comment " .endif -.include <bsd.port.pre.mk> - pre-configure: -.if ${OSVERSION} < 700041 - ${REINPLACE_CMD} -E -e 's|^(LDFLAGS.*)|\1 -lthr|' \ - ${WRKSRC}/src/framework/Makefile \ - ${WRKSRC}/src/modules/avformat/Makefile \ - ${WRKSRC}/src/modules/core/Makefile \ - ${WRKSRC}/src/modules/dv/Makefile \ - ${WRKSRC}/src/modules/sdl/Makefile -.endif ${REINPLACE_CMD} -e 's|-pthread|${PTHREAD_LIBS}|g' \ ${WRKSRC}/configure \ ${WRKSRC}/src/swig/*/build @@ -193,4 +192,4 @@ post-install: .endfor .endif -.include <bsd.port.post.mk> +.include <bsd.port.mk> diff --git a/multimedia/mlt/distinfo b/multimedia/mlt/distinfo index 0b8d792987fa..287f58fa3a3b 100644 --- a/multimedia/mlt/distinfo +++ b/multimedia/mlt/distinfo @@ -1,3 +1,2 @@ -MD5 (mlt-0.5.10.tar.gz) = 6869ed138193cc0e3113e4e7ac341e14 -SHA256 (mlt-0.5.10.tar.gz) = 106636540cdf44f670937b8df549ea2c988a27d05e14d4a8670f9b6af5a0d19e -SIZE (mlt-0.5.10.tar.gz) = 819471 +SHA256 (mlt-0.6.0.tar.gz) = 91a0d916a39f03b437192a6e0c34354996458a8892ce0c91740c9881ea14746e +SIZE (mlt-0.6.0.tar.gz) = 860173 diff --git a/multimedia/mlt/pkg-plist b/multimedia/mlt/pkg-plist index e3c8048d7c88..2ae5356aebeb 100644 --- a/multimedia/mlt/pkg-plist +++ b/multimedia/mlt/pkg-plist @@ -48,14 +48,16 @@ include/mlt/framework/mlt_tokeniser.h include/mlt/framework/mlt_tractor.h include/mlt/framework/mlt_transition.h include/mlt/framework/mlt_types.h +include/mlt/framework/mlt_version.h lib/libmlt++.so -lib/libmlt++.so.0.5.10 +lib/libmlt++.so.0.6.0 lib/libmlt++.so.3 lib/libmlt.so -lib/libmlt.so.0.5.10 -lib/libmlt.so.2 +lib/libmlt.so.0.6.0 +lib/libmlt.so.3 %%AVFORMAT%%lib/mlt/libmltavformat.so lib/mlt/libmltcore.so +lib/mlt/libmltdecklink.so lib/mlt/libmltdgraft.so %%DV%%lib/mlt/libmltdv.so lib/mlt/libmlteffectv.so @@ -73,6 +75,7 @@ lib/mlt/libmltplus.so %%RESAMPLE%%lib/mlt/libmltresample.so lib/mlt/libmltsdl.so %%SOX%%lib/mlt/libmltsox.so +%%SWFDEC%%lib/mlt/libmltswfdec.so lib/mlt/libmltvmfx.so %%VORBIS%%lib/mlt/libmltvorbis.so lib/mlt/libmltxine.so @@ -84,6 +87,7 @@ libdata/pkgconfig/mlt-framework.pc %%DATADIR%%/core/loader.dict %%DATADIR%%/core/loader.ini %%DATADIR%%/feeds/NTSC/data_fx.properties +%%DATADIR%%/feeds/NTSC/etv.properties %%DATADIR%%/feeds/NTSC/obscure.properties %%DATADIR%%/feeds/PAL/border.properties %%DATADIR%%/feeds/PAL/data_fx.properties |